Abstract

Introduction: Chronic Monteggia fracture is a rare and clinically challenging condition, characterized by a non-union fracture of the proximal ulna with dislocation of the radial head. This case report presents the case of a 42-year-old woman with a chronic Monteggia fracture diagnosed 21 years after the initial injury, highlighting the importance of a careful patient history and radiographic investigation. Case presentation: A 42-year-old woman presented with left elbow pain and a history of significant trauma 21 years previously. Physical examination revealed limited range of motion and radiographic examination revealed a nonfused fracture of the proximal ulna with dislocation of the radial head. The patient underwent open reduction and internal fixation (ORIF) reconstruction of the ulna and excision of the radial head. Conclusion: Successful surgical reconstruction of chronic Monteggia fractures results in significant improvements in the patient's function and quality of life. This case report emphasizes the importance of early diagnosis and timely surgical intervention to prevent long-term complications and achieve optimal functional outcomes.

Abstract

Osteoarthritis (OA) is inflammation of the joints due to degenerative damage to the cartilage and surrounding tissue. The degenerative nature of osteoarthritis develop slowly, but this can cause disability and failure of joint function accompanied by pain. risk factors for OA are age, gender, genetics, obesity, ethnicity, metabolic disease, work, exercise, joint injuries, and growth disorders. Osteoarthritis can attack various joints in the body, but more often affects joints that support the body's weight, such as the knee joint and hip joint. The knee joint is a joint that is very often affected by OA. Data from the Central for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) shows that as much as 40% of the population aged > 70 years suffer from knee OA. To determine the incidence, risk factors and relationship between risk factors for the occurrence of Knee Osteoarthritis at Bhayangkara Hospital Makassar in 2023. This Method Description research using a Cross Sectional approach. The incidence of Knee Osteoarthritis at Bhayangkara Makassar Hospital in 2023 there were 186 patients, the presentation of patient age <40 years in this study was 28.5% and >40 years is 71.5%, the gender presentation of patients in this study were male as much as 31.7% and women as much as 68.3%, the distribution of obesity in this study was 68.3% and not obese as much as 31.7%, the presentation of work patients on the incidence of osteoarthritis where in this study 33.9% worked and 66.1% did not work and there was a relationship between age, gender, obesity and work on the incidence of osteoarthritis. Based on the research results, it can be concluded that there is a relationship between age, gender, obesity and occupation with the incidence of Knee Osteoarthritis at Bhayangkara Hospital in 2023.

Abstract

Osteoarthritis gentle is one of the degenerative diseases that often occurs in the elderly population, characteristics by progressive damage to the knee joint cartilage that causes pain, limited mobility, and decreased quality of life. This study aims to analyze the characteristics of osteoarthritis gentle patients, including demographic profiles, risk factors, severity, and selected treatment patterns, in order to provide more effective intervention recommendations. The method used is a literature review by collect and analyzing various previous studies related to osteoarthritis gentle, especially those discussing risk factors, treatment patterns, and health service challenges. The results of the study showed that the majority of patients were postmenopausal women with high levels of obesity, low physical activity, and a history of joint injury. Many patients are late in accessing medical treatment and rely on alternative therapies that have not been proven effective. This study highlights the importance of public education, increasing access to health services, and more targeted health policies to prevent and treat osteoarthritis gentle optimally.
